Ingredients You’ll Need for This Chicken Taco Soup

Gathering the ingredients for this soup is like assembling a patchwork quilt of flavors, each adding its own unique touch to the final masterpiece. Here’s what you’ll need:

  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 medium onion, diced
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 pound bo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cubed
  • 1 packet taco seasoning (or homemade blend)
  • 4 cups chicken broth
  • 1 can (14.5 oz) diced tomatoes
  • 1 can (15 oz) black beans, drained and rinsed
  • 1 can (15 oz) corn kernels, drained
  • 1 cup salsa
  • 1 teaspoon ground cumin
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Optional toppings: shredded cheese, sour cream, cilantro, lime wedges, avocado

Instructions

Creating this soup is a delightful process, one that’s as rewarding as it is simple. Follow these steps, and you’ll have a pot of warmth and love ready in no time:

  1. Heat the olive oil in a large pot over medium heat. Add the diced onion and sauté until it becomes translucent, about 5 minutes. Stir in the minced garlic and cook for another minute.
  2. Add the cubed chicken breasts to the pot, cooking until they’re browned on the outside, roughly 6-7 minutes.
  3. Stir in the taco seasoning, ensuring the chicken is evenly coated. This is where the magic begins, as the spices start to infuse the chicken with bold flavors.
  4. Pour in the chicken broth, diced tomatoes, black beans, corn, and salsa. Stir to combine all the ingredients.
  5.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ce the heat and let it simmer for 20 minutes, allowing all the flavors to meld beautifully.
  6. Season with ground cumin, salt, and pepper to taste. Adjust the seasoning based on your family’s preference—this is where your personal touch comes in.
  7. Serve hot, with your choice of toppings. I love adding a dollop of sour cream and a sprinkle of cilantro, just like how my grandmother would finish her dishes with a flourish of fresh herbs.

Tips for Making the Best Chicken Taco Soup

Through years of making this soup, I’ve picked up a few tips to elevate it from good to unforgettable:

  • Use homemade taco seasoning: While store-bought is convenient, making your own blend allows you to control the salt and spice levels to suit your family’s taste.
  • Experiment with toppings: Think beyond the usual suspects—try adding a handful of crushed tortilla chips for a bit of crunch.

Storage and Reheating Tips

One of the joys of this soup is that it tastes even better the next day, once the flavors have had more time to meld. Here’s how to store and reheat it:

  • Refrigerate: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days.
  • Freeze: This soup freezes beautifully! Portion it into freezer-safe containers and store for up to 3 months.
  • Reheat: Warm up the soup on the stove over medium heat, stirring occasionally, until heated through. If frozen, let it thaw in the refrigerator overnight before reheating.
